Heme oxygenase (HO), which produces carbon monoxide (CO) by oxygenation of heme, is present in neocortical pyramidal cells. In this study, we investigated the role of CO in neocortical long-term potentiation (LTP) using slices prepared from the rat auditory cortex. Tetanic stimulation of layer IV pruduced LTP of field potentials in layer II/III (LTP_II/III ) and in layer V (LTP_v ). CO (8 nM-5 ,uM) showed no significant effect on LTP_II/III , while CO significantly suppressed LTP_v at concentrations of 40 nM and 200 nM. N^G-nitro-Larginine(NA, 10 ,uM), a NO synthase inhibitor, blocked LTP_v • This blockade of LTP_v by 10,uM NA was reversed by 8-bromo-cGMP (Br-cGMP, 1 mM), a membranepermeable cyclic GMP analog. CO (40 nM) did not suppress LTP_v in the presence of 10,uM NA and 1 mM Br-cGMP. o-Aminolevulinic acid(ALA, 30,uM), which is a substrate for heme synthesis and is believed to facilitate endogenous CO production, significantly suppressed LTP_v • ALA showed no effect on LTP_II/III • These results strongly suggest that LTP_v but not LTP_II/III is suppressed by exogenous and endogenous CO probably via suppression of NO-induced cGMP formation. | |||||
